Abstract
Annona deceptrix (Westra) H. Rainer belongs to the Annonaceae family which is known to have bioactivities such as antioxidant, antimicrobial, anticancer, anti-inflamatory, pesticide, among others. A. deceptrix ethanolic seed and leaf extracts obtained by three extraction methods (Soxhlet, ultrasound, and maceration) were tested for phytochemical and antioxidant activities. Phytochemical screening of plant extracts revealed the presence of catechins, triterpenes, tannins, alkaloids, flavonoids, amino acids, cardiac glycosides, anthocyanidins, reducing sugars, and saponins. Quantitative determination of total phenolic, flavonoid contents, and antioxidant activities of extracts was carried out using colorimetric methods. The highest total phenolic content was 58.14 and 54.08 mg GAE/g DW for Soxhlet extracts from leaves and seeds, respectively. The highest total flavonoid content was 5.03 and 4.42 mg QE/ g DW for macerated and ultrasound-assisted extracts from leaves, respectively. Antioxidant activity by the DPPH method was 196.07 and 146.53 μmol TE/g DW for Soxhlet extracts from seeds and leaves, respectively, and by the ABTS method was 582.68 and 580.40 μmol TE/g DW for Soxhlet and macerated extracts from leaves, respectively. Further research is needed to optimize the use of such bioactive compounds produced by Annona deceptrix and apply their biological activities in the pharmaceutical, food, cosmetic, or agrochemical industries.

The BJB – Brazilian Journal of Biology® is a scientific journal devoted to publishing original articles in all fields of the Biological Sciences, i.e., General Biology, Cell Biology, Evolution, Biological Oceanography, Taxonomy, Geographic Distribution, Limnology, Aquatic Biology, Botany, Zoology, Genetics, and Ecology. Priority is given to papers presenting results of researches in the Neotropical region. Material published includes research papers, review papers (upon approval of the Editorial Board), notes, book reviews, and comments.
